Brothers aged 9 and 6 who vanished after being dropped off at school found safe and well

A major search has been called off after two young brothers who vanished after being dropped off at school were found.

Michael and James O'Brien, aged 9 and 6 respectively, were dropped off for class in Rosewell at around 8am this morning.

The two boys failed to enter the school, leading to a major search operation being launched.

Police officers and dog units were searching the Midlothian town before the two brothers were found.

They are said to be safe and well.

A spokesperson for Midlothian Police said: “We are pleased to report Michael and Jamie O’Brien, missing from Rosewell this morning, have been traced safe and well.

“We would like to thank members of the public and our partners who shared information and assisted us with inquiries.”
